CV23 1 is a postcode sector in Rugby. Homes here sold for a median of £349,000 over the last year, up 11.3% over five years. 1,643 sales are on record. It sits among England’s less-deprived areas (100% of its postcodes are in the least-deprived 30%). 100% of homes are rated EPC C or better.
- £339,950 median sold price (all time)
- £349,000 median price, last 12 months
- 1,643 recorded sales
- +11.3% 5-year price change
- 100% of postcodes in England’s least-deprived 30%
- 100% of homes rated EPC C or better
- Source: HM Land Registry Price Paid & English Indices of Deprivation, Jul 2026
